Overview

Registered Nurse (RN) Outpatient Surgery/Endoscopy

4 or 8-hour shifts per week. No nights, weekends, or holidays. Possible call shifts.

Assesses and manages the care of assigned patients providing patient centred care that identifies, respects, and addresses patients’ differences, values, preferences, and expressed needs. Patient centred care also involves the coordination of continuous care, listening to, communicating with, and educating patients and caregivers related to health, wellness, and disease management and prevention. The registered nurse is able to exercise good judgement, delegate as needed, maintain good interpersonal relationships, adapt to change, evaluate critically, think creatively, and have effective communication skills.

The registered nurse provides the link between healthcare and the patient by helping to translate the plan of care to the patient and developing a nurse patient partnership.

Responsibilities
  • Assesses and monitors total physiological, psychological, sociocultural, and spiritual needs of infant, child, adolescent, adult and geriatric patients.
  • Develops and maintains with the patient/significant other, an individualized, professionally modified plan of care reflective of changing needs/goals as determined by evaluating the patient/significant other response to the plan of care.
  • Provides nursing care in accordance with nursing standards and the infant, child, adolescent, adult and geriatric patient's plan of care.
  • Assesses and plans for discharge needs, evaluates adult and geriatric patients and significant others educational needs and initiates and implements appropriate teaching protocols or makes appropriate referrals.
  • Communicates with other members of the healthcare team in order to ensure continuity of care and coordination of services.
  • Participates in unit operations demonstrating professional behaviors to include supporting goals of nursing unit and maintaining awareness of resource utilization.
  • Participates in non-direct patient care activities including educational activities, performance improvement activities, standards development and review, hospital/nursing committees and other related activities.
  • Demonstrates technical skills proficiently for the comfort and safety of infant, child, adolescent, adult and geriatric patients.
  • Demonstrates positive customer relation skills.
  • Provides nursing care utilizing a knowledge base and understanding regarding medical necessity.
  • Demonstrates support of organizational values of caring, integrity, responsible stewardship, continuous improvement, learning and excellence.
  • Consistently demonstrates the ability to anticipate and prepare for changes within the patient group ( admissions, discharges, transfers, increased patient care needs, etc)
  • Utilizes a family centered, patient focused approach to plan, direct and evaluate patient care needs.
